Photographic Art

Photographic art refers to the creation of fine art using photography as the primary medium. Photographic art encompasses a wide range of styles and techniques, including traditional fine art photography, photojournalism, documentary photography, and digital manipulation. The goal of photographic art is to use the medium of photography to create images that are aesthetically compelling and emotionally engaging, rather than solely informative or descriptive. Photographic art often explores themes such as identity, memory, place, and time, and can range from representational images that depict the world as it is, to abstract images that push the boundaries of what is possible with the medium. Photographic art can be created using a variety of techniques. The rise of digital technology has greatly expanded the possibilities of photographic art, allowing artists to manipulate and transform images in new and innovative ways.
